EARLY GRADUATION
Alternative graduation possibilities at Carrabec High School are:
1.) Graduation in three (3) years
2.) Graduation in absentia
A.) Foreign exchange studies
B.) College in lieu of senior year
C.) Military service
D.) Full-time employment
To be eligible for early graduation the following steps are expected:
1.) The student must present a letter of intent to the RSU #74 Guidance Director by April 1st of the student's sophomore year, if possible.
2.) The parents or the legal guardian of the student must present a letter, which supports student's intent, to the Guidance Director. The parents or the legal guardian will be requested to meet with school officials to discuss the options which are available to the student that will help complete a plan which will ensure the student can meet RSU #74 graduation requirements.
3.) The Guidance Director then refers the letter of intent and plan to the Carrabec High School Principal for approval.
After receiving approval by administration, the student will participate in school activities as a member of the junior
class. If at the end of the first semester, the student is meeting the expectations outlined in the approved plan, the
student will be moved to senior status and will follow the same procedures and regulations relating to graduation
activities as other seniors.
